Software Engineering Intern

Location: San Francisco
Term: Summer
Work Type: In-person

About Infragrid

We’re building Infragrid to end the tax of manual financial work. By capturing how businesses operate—using SOPs, screen recordings, and analyst expertise—we compile these processes into deterministic software. The result is an operational platform that powers AI automation across industries like insurance, banking, and commercial real estate. We’re backed by a16z, and our team includes engineers from Palantir, Mercor, and AWS.

What You’ll Do

  • Ship production software from day one.

  • Participate in customer calls and design solutions directly with founders.

  • Deploy solutions quickly—often within the same week.

You’ll work across:

  • Workflow engine

  • Ontology and data model

  • AI-powered applications

  • Screen-recorder-to-code platform

  • Infrastructure and backend systems

What We’re Looking For

  • Builders who have developed products people actually use and understand real-world software challenges.

  • Comfort with:

    • React, TypeScript, Python

    • SQL and API development

    • AWS or modern cloud infrastructure

    • Building AI products with LLMs, RAG, or agentic systems

You’ll own more product surface area in one summer than most engineers see in their first year at a large company.
